The Honolulu Sunrise Club would like to share a message about an opportunity for Oahu residents to plant trees on our home island: On Saturday, April 28, 2018, over a thousand plants and trees will be propagated and brought to the Manoa Marketplace to be distributed to the community and people all over the island. This year, the variety will include kukui nut trees, variegated hao trees, mountain apple trees, plumeria trees, papaya trees, red and green ti plants, panax, lauae ferns, valentine vines, ice cream bean trees, avocado trees, false wiliwili trees, monstera, monkey pod trees, naupaka, bestill trees, snow bush, kalo, staghorn ferns, coconut trees, yellow ginger, and many others.
